Consistency saves time
A small set of rules prevents every flyer, slide or social post from becoming a new design project.
Start with the basics
Define colours, typography, spacing, image style and a few repeatable layouts. These choices are enough to create recognisable output.
Templates are not a limitation
Good templates create freedom. They allow people to move faster while keeping the brand recognisable.
Make decisions visible
Document the choices in simple language. People should not need to guess which font size, colour or layout to use.
Keep it practical
A design system only works if people actually use it. Start small, improve what is repeated often and leave rare exceptions alone.
